    The role of company secretary has always carried significant legal weight — maintaining statutory registers, lodging ASIC forms on time, ensuring resolutions are properly executed, keeping directors informed, and managing obligations across every entity in the portfolio. For most of the past decade, that work has been done manually: spreadsheets, shared drives, Word templates, and a lot of institutional knowledge stored in one person's head.

    AI has changed what's possible. The best AI company secretary software in 2026 doesn't just automate reminders — it understands your entity structure, drafts governance documents from live data, monitors compliance in real time, and files directly with ASIC without requiring a portal login. This guide compares the leading options for Australian corporate groups.

    What Makes AI Company Secretary Software Different in 2026

    Traditional company secretary software was essentially a digital filing cabinet — a place to store documents and track deadlines. AI company secretary software is fundamentally different. Instead of passive storage, it actively monitors every entity against its compliance obligations, surfaces issues before they become penalties, and generates governance documents automatically from the data it holds.

    The practical difference: a company secretary managing 50 entities in 2023 spent 60–80% of their time on manual data entry, form preparation, and deadline tracking. The best AI platforms in 2026 have reduced that to 20–30%, freeing governance professionals to focus on judgment, strategy, and stakeholder communication rather than administration.

    Key capabilities to look for in 2026:

    • Real-time compliance scoring per entity against jurisdictional rules
    • AI document drafting from live entity data (not blank templates)
    • Direct ASIC lodgement without manual portal login
    • Automatic beneficial ownership tracing through trust structures
    • Live register reconciliation against the ASIC public register

    What to Look for When Choosing AI Company Secretary Software

    1. ASIC integration depth — Direct lodgement (ASIC DSP only) eliminates a full step from every compliance workflow.

    2. AI document drafting — from live data or templates? — Live data eliminates transcription risk. Templates still require manual entry.

    3. Compliance monitoring — reactive or proactive? — Proactive AI monitors continuously and surfaces issues before deadlines become penalties.

    4. UBO and beneficial ownership capability — Australian AML/CTF obligations and emerging mandatory UBO register requirements make beneficial ownership tracing increasingly important.
